Bethany Ross is the Executive Director of Brown Bagging for Calgary's Kids, a community-driven organization dedicated to ensuring every child has access to the food they need to thrive. With more than 20 years of experience in the charitable and human services sector, Bethany has built her career around bringing people together to create meaningful change. Since joining Brown Bagging for Calgary's Kids more than a decade ago, she has helped grow a movement powered by volunteers, donors, schools, businesses, and community members who believe that no child should go hungry. Known as a thoughtful leader, problem-solver, and community builder, Bethany is passionate about creating dignified and accessible solutions for families facing food insecurity. On this episode of CREATE, Bethany shares insights on leadership, community impact, the power of collective action, and how small acts of kindness can come together to create extraordinary change for kids and families.
